Add support for parsing the ARM Error Source Table and basic handling of
errors reported through both memory mapped and system register interfaces.

Assume system register interfaces are only registered with private
peripheral interrupts (PPIs); otherwise there is no guarantee the
core handling the error is the core which took the error and has the
syndrome info in its system registers.

In kernel-first mode, all configuration is controlled by kernel, include
CE ce_threshold and interrupt enable/disable.

All detected errors will be processed as follow:
  - CE, DE: use a workqueue to log this hardware errors.
  - UER, UEO: log it and call memory_failure in workquee.
  - UC, UEU: panic in irq context.

+config ACPI_AEST
+	bool "ARM Error Source Table Support"
+
+	help
+	  The Arm Error Source Table (AEST) provides details on ACPI
+	  extensions that enable kernel-first handling of errors in a
+	  system that supports the Armv8 RAS extensions.
+
+	  If set, the kernel will report and log hardware errors.

This series adds support for the ARM Error Source Table (AEST) based on
the 1.1 version of ACPI for the Armv8 RAS Extensions [0].

The Arm Error Source Table (AEST) enable kernel-first handling of errors
in a system that supports the Armv8 RAS extensions. In kernel-first mode,
kernel controls almost all RAS configuration, include CE threshold and
interrupt enable/disable. Hardware errors will trigger a RAS interrupt
to kernel, kernel scan all AEST node to find error node which occur
error in irq context and process the RAS error. Kernel will act as
follow for different types error:
  - CE, DE: use a workqueue to log this hardware errors.
  - UER, UEO: call memory_failure.
  - UC, UEU: panic.

I have tested this series on PTG Yitian710 SOC. Both corrected and
uncorrected errors were tested to verify the non-fatal vs fatal
scenarios.
